HIP 92746
HIP 92746 is a B-type (Blue-White) star.
Located approximately 560.4 light-years from Earth, HIP 92746 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 92746 is classified as a spectral class B star (B-type (Blue-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 92746 has an apparent magnitude of +8.27,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its blue-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.104.
